I did have quite a bit of bruising- straight down the middle of my
chest; however, that subsided after a couple of weeks. It felt
VERY tight initially-like I couldn't breathe in all the way. Also, I
felt like I had an elephant sitting on my chest due to the
tightness. Not fun, but bearable IF you take your meds. The tip
about sleeping in a recliner is very good- I had to sleep with
about 10 pillows under me for the same result- you can't push
yourself up from a horizontal postion. The smoking issue is
due to anethesia- it makes it more difficult to sleep and arouse
you if you are a smoker due to decreased pulmonary function.

The pain went away in about 3-4 days (meds helped) sleeping was the hardest a recliner or those support chairs for reading in bed are great. I had inframam incision (underneath). The scar is fading beautifully, you can still see it a little bit, but only when you lift and look for it (remember this is a fresh scar, so I expect it to fade even more).
Advice- the only thing that I didn't realize was the extent of discomfort of the nipple, my Dr. said it doesn't always happen but you can get hypersensitivity (which really hurts!) I learned a little late that all you have to do is put a band aid on them so they don't rub on your clothes. problem fixed! It is not as bad now but still a little sensitive, I was told it takes 9 months for this to completely go away and in some cases it won't. But this also mean you won't feeling.
